Anwilka 2015
Described by top critic Robert Parker as "the finest red wine I have ever had from South Africa" on its debut vintage, this is classy stuff. A dense, dark blend of Syrah, Cabernet and spicy Petit Verdot, it is elegant, supple, yet lavish and rich.

The Story Behind the Bottle
This is a superb single estate red from the premium vineyards of Stellenbosch. They lie just 7 kilometres from the coast in the premium district of Helderberg. The property was founded in the late 1990s by former owner of Klein Constantia Lowell Jooste and two top names from Bordeaux, Bruno Prats (former owner of Cos d'Estournel) and Hubert de Boüard (co-owner of Château Angélus) and immediately made a name for itself. It is now owned by the renowned Klein Constantia, with Jean du Plessis as winemaker. Aged for 15 months in new French oak barrels, this is a gorgeously rich and lavish red, deep in cassis, toasted mocha and dark chocolate notes. Open early and decant to reveal all its layers. A wine to serve with fine red meat or game dishes.
